ZooBoo to bring kids spooky Halloween entertainment

2 min read

ZooBoo, the Pittsburgh Zoo & PPG Aquarium’s annual Halloween spook-tacular runs today through Sunday from 6 to 9:30 p.m. Admission gates close at 8:30 p.m. For older children, the Haunted House in the Niches of the World building offers a spooky good time. Activities at Kasper’s Craft Korner, located in Kids Kingdom, will entertain the little ones with crafts and story telling. All children will have a screamingly good time on the Halloween Train Ride and Monster Splash at the PPG Aquarium, featuring costumed characters, music and more.

ZooBoo is a fun-filled and safe family event featuring trick-or-treating and lots of exciting activities for children of all ages. Admission to ZooBoo is $3 for zoo members and $5 for non-members, with children under the age of 2 admitted free. Parking is free.

With the exception of the Train Ride and Carousel, which cost $1 each, all activities are free.

ZooBoo offers free candy and treats from area businesses and organizations such as 7-Eleven, the Pepsi Bottling Company, Sorrento Cheese and the Shriners.

Conveniently accessible from all sides of the city, the Pittsburgh Zoo & PPG Aquarium is open every day except Dec. 25.
